Output 9684ec3d1a592004fe03422b127fb64161ae27aae5f7516ad1c158fa7493b325:3

value
1104243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c812ef5691d2e1b617b25e68c80b45b769031ec OP_EQUAL
address
37CwDskTHvtD45rfJeETbw2pkCdTYm9f77
transaction
9684ec3d1a592004fe03422b127fb64161ae27aae5f7516ad1c158fa7493b325
confirmations
270109
spent
true